Web23 nov. 2024 · Photo Credit: Norsepower. The rotating, cylindrical Flettner rotor sail is a mechanical sail that was first invented in the early 20 th century by Finnish engineer Sigurd Savonius. It was then popularized (and named after) German aviation engineer Anton Flettner, who successfully sailed a prototype rotor ship across the Atlantic in 1926. WebBusiness, Economics, and Finance. WebRace sailing boats are the ones that have recorded the fastest speeds than regular sailboats. Conclusion. A sailboat can go as fast as 20 knots, but the average speed of a sailboat is 4-6 knots. The fastest sailboat is V.0.60 monohull with a speed of 36 knots. A sailboat can go as fast as the wind or even faster under the right conditions. WebThe America’s Cup sailboats are sleek and fast. The AC72, the type of catamaran used in this year’s race, can travel almost three times the speed of the prevailing wind. On June 18 th Emirates Team New Zealand recorded a speed of 50.8 mph (44.1 knots), with a wind speed of about 18 mph (15.6 knots).

On June … easiest university coursesWeb10 sep. 2012 · See answer (1) Best Answer. Copy. This depends upon its water line length. The maximum top speed of a schooner is limited by its waterline and its effective sail area and sail plan. The maximum theoretical speed is calculated by taking its hull length at the water line (not overall length), find its square root, then multiplying that value by 1.3. ct weather henri
